Slaughtering Operations (Hog/Swine/Pig) (NC II) 160 … WebJan 12, 2024 · TESDA TRAINING REGULATIONS FOR FOOD PROCESSING NC IV. The TESDA Course in Food Processing NC IV consists of competencies that a person must achieve to set up and operate production and packaging lines and systems, participate in evaluation processes, and monitor practices and procedures..
